Failed to connect due to a DNS error – Zippy successfully connected to a wireless access point but
was unable to connect to the Internet.
Possible causes: 1) Your Internet service provider is having a service outage
2) Your cable or DSL modem is turned off or is malfunctioning
3) The DHCP server on your access point has provided incorrect data (this is
rare).
Solutions: 1 and 2) Verify that you can access the Internet from a PC. If not, check the
status of your cable or DSL modem to see if it is receiving data from the
Internet. (Status lights are typically provided.) 3) ???
Failed to connect because you are unauthorized to access this network – Zippy could not
connect to the network because it requires a subscription service or hourly fee.
Note: After the first successful connection to a wireless network, Zippy IM will always attempt to
connect to networks it has previously connected to before attempting to connect to new networks.
